What Does Numbers 15:23 Mean?

The phrase 'by the hand of Moses' affirms Moses as God's instrument for communicating law. The continuity from Moses' time forward ensures that future generations inherit the same covenant obligations.

The breadth of 'all that the LORD hath commanded' covers the entire body of law, establishing that this law regarding unintentional sin applies to every commandment without exception.
